Manicurist Program Highlights

  • Hybrid flexibility: Complete theory hours online from home, so studying can fit around work, family, and life. Day and evening courses available.
  • Technique-first class time: In-person sessions focus on hands-on demonstration, guided practice, and instructor feedback.
  • Nail service fundamentals: Build repeatable skills in prep, shaping, polish application, and salon sanitation habits.
  • Bilingual instruction: Classes are offered in English and Spanish, so you can learn in the language that is best for you.
  • State-approved curriculum: Training aligns with California State Board requirements and is designed to help you prepare to sit for the state board exam.
  • Instructor support: Learn with coaching that helps you refine your technique and professional habits from experienced professionals.
  • Real-client practice opportunities: Build confidence through supervised service experience—all services provided by students under the supervision of licensed professionals.

Manicurist Program FAQs

How long is the Manicurist Program?

Our manicurist training includes 400 clock hours. How long it takes you to complete the program will depend on your attendance and how quickly you progress through the skills training. If you’d like to know an approximate graduation date, our admissions team can help you plan a realistic timeline based on your schedule and start date.

Do you offer financial aid?

Alva Beauty Collective does not currently offer federal financial aid. We plan to offer financial aid in the future and will keep you updated on the process. In the meantime, you can use our in-house payment plans to help manage the cost of tuition. Ask our team about current payment plan options.

What's the difference between a Manicurist Program and Cosmetology?

The Manicurist Program focuses exclusively on nail services, so training is typically shorter than Cosmetology. Cosmetology training covers a broader range of services, including nails, hair, and skin. If your main interest is nails, then the Manicurist Training Program may be right for you. Enrollment Requirements and Next Steps to Starting Manicurist Training

To start the admissions and enrollment process, schedule a campus tour to see the training space and ask us any questions you might have. After that, we can help you start your admissions application and provide a list of the documents you’ll need to submit. Once accepted, you can choose to start training on any Monday!

To enroll, most applicants will need:

  • To be at least 16.5 years old to enroll (and 17 to take state licensing exams)
  • A valid state-issued photo ID or passport
  • A Social Security or ITIN number
  • Successful completion of Alva’s Entrance Assessment OR proof of a high school education, such as a diploma or GED
